Affordability of Living in Harvard, IL

The median home value is $274,030
MonthMedian home value
May 2025$264k
June 2025$264k
July 2025$265k
August 2025$265k
September 2025$266k
October 2025$267k
November 2025$268k
December 2025$270k
January 2026$271k
February 2026$273k
March 2026$274k
April 2026$274k

Average Home Value in Harvard, IL, by Home Size

Currently, there are 5 new listings in Harvard, IL and 34 homes for sale.
Home SizeHome Value*
2 bedrooms (2 homes)$198,535
3 bedrooms (11 homes)$275,146
4 bedrooms (5 homes)$309,548
*Home value over the past month
